公開日:2023.12.07

Shopifyでメタフィールドを使ってコレクションごとにフィルターの非表示指定ができるようにする設定例

Shopifyでメタフィールドを使ってコレクションごとにフィルターの非表示指定ができるようにする設定例

用途

  • コレクション情報管理・編集

実装方法

  • LIQUID
詳細を表示する

Shopifyのコレクション絞り込みフィルターは全てのページで共通です。掲載商品に該当項目がなければ自動でその項目は非表示になるので十分便利なのですが、それでもコレクションごとに特定のフィルターを敢えて非表示にしたいことがあります。メタフィールドを使った設定方法の実装例です。


メタフィールドを使ってコレクションごとにフィルターの非表示指定ができるようにする設定例


【設定手順①】コレクションメタフィールドに非表示にするフィルター名を入力するための単一行のテキスト(リスト)項目を追加


【設定手順②】コレクションのフィルターセクション「facets.liquid」のコードの2箇所を編集


ご購入(すべて¥0です)いただくと、サンプルコードをご覧いただけるようになります。

すでにご購入済みの方はこちらからログインしてください。

サンプルコード

動作検証済テーマ:Dawn/Rise 15.2.0

コレクションのフィルターセクション「facets.liquid」のコードの2箇所を編集

関連ポスト